‘Telangana emerging as automobile hub’

State’s first e-biking challenge kicks off at BVRIT

March 14, 2018 11:35 pm | Updated 11:35 pm IST - NARSAPUR (MEDAK DT.)

Telangana is slowly but surely emerging as an automobile hub with several automobile companies eyeing the State for investment opportunities, asserted K.V. Vishnu Raju, chairman of Sri Vishnu Educational Society.

He was addressing students after inaugurating the State’s first Indian Pro-Kart Endurance Championship and Asian E-Bike Challenge at B.V. Raju Institute of Technology (BVRIT) on Tuesday.

The mechanical engineering department of BVRIT is holding a national-level Go-Kart racing event till March 16 in collaboration with ‘Imagine to Innovate.’ Over 1000 students and 50 teams from across India are participating in the event.

‘Imagine to Innovate Asia E-bike Challenge’ is an eco-friendly venture based on engineering design and manufacturing of electric bike by the students.

Automobile expert and MD of Deccan Auto Rao M. Chalasani said more girls are opting for mechanical engineering, and that there has been a surge in the number of girls working in assembly line of Ford.
